What is the Mews MCP Server?
Connect your Mews hotel to any AI agent and transform your front desk into an intelligent, voice-ready concierge.
What you can do
- Reservations — Today's check-ins, upcoming arrivals, room assignments, and booking status
- Guests — Search profiles, loyalty tiers, preferences, allergies, and past stays
- Rooms — Real-time room status: vacant/occupied, housekeeping (clean/dirty/inspected)
- Billing — Guest folios, charges, payments, and balance tracking
- Rates & Services — Rate plans, bookable services, and POS outlet items
- Property — Hotel configuration, departments, and operational settings

Frequently asked questions
What types of hotels use Mews?
Mews serves 5,000+ properties in 85+ countries — from boutique hotels and hostels to luxury resorts and hotel groups. It's a cloud-native PMS designed for modern hospitality.
Is the Mews API suitable for large hotel groups?
Yes, Mews provides a robust API that supports multi-property operations, making it ideal for hotel groups to manage central reservations, corporate billing, and group-wide reporting.
Can I check room housekeeping status in real-time?
Yes, you can query Mews to get the real-time status of any room, including whether it is clean, dirty, inspected, or out of order, which helps prioritize housekeeping efforts.
How does Cline connect to MCP servers?
Cline reads MCP server configurations from its settings panel in VS Code. Add the server URL and Cline discovers all available tools on initialization.
Can Cline run MCP tools without approval?
By default, Cline asks for confirmation before executing tool calls. You can configure auto-approval rules for trusted servers in the settings.
Does Cline support multiple MCP servers at once?
Yes. Configure as many servers as needed. Cline can use tools from different servers within the same autonomous task execution.
Server shows error in sidebar
Click the server name to see logs. Verify the URL and token are correct.
